Description
The supplementary videos SV1 and SV2 (presented in Figures 4 and 5) show geophysical flows impacting flexible, slit, and rigid barriers via pile-up mode and runup mode, respectively.
The measurement data used for comparison in Figure 7 from 14 centrifuge tests with bouldery and the boulder-debris mixture flows (Song et al., 2018b, 2019), and dry granular flow against open-type dams (Choi et al., 2020) were published open access in their articles.
The unique dataset, comprising normalized data obtained from analytical models (Li et al., 2021; Song et al., 2021a), empirical relations (Cui et al., 2015), experiments (Armanini et al., 2020; Choi et al., 2020; Cui et al., 2015; Hu et al., 2020; Song et al., 2021a, 2021b; Tiberghien et al., 2007; Vicari et al., 2021), field events (Hübl et al., 2009), and practical design values (Armanini, 1997; Hungr et al., 1984; Kwan & Cheung, 2012; Wendeler, 2016), is plotted in Figure 10 for comparison.
All these articles can be found in the PDF file entitled “References in Figures 7 and 10”.
